COURSE OVERVIEW

  • Mechanical Engineering deals with the design, manufacture and maintenance of a wide range of industrial appliances. This field of study is suitable for persons who have the ability to work with their hands.
  • Mechanical Engineering NATED courses is aimed at equipping students with a solid technical foundation and practical skills, ensuring they are job-ready for the mechanical engineering industry upon graduation.

The National N-Diploma is a three years qualification consisting of a theoretical part (N4 – N6) and two years industry experience in the Electrical Engineering field. The N4 – N6 Certificate Programmes are leading towards obtaining a National N-Diploma. Each certificate is a qualification on its own and is offered over a period of 3 month.

 

M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S

  • N3 Engineering Certificate or Grade 12 (with Maths, Science and Drawing)
  • or any equivalent qualification.

 

COURSE DURATION

The duration of each N-Level is three months (per Trimester).

 

ENROLMENT DATE

January, May and September of each year

NQF LEVEL STATUS

N4 – SAQA ID 66881- NQF LEVEL 5

N5 – SAQA ID 66960- NQF LEVEL 5

N6 – SAQA ID 67005- NQF LEVEL 5
